06. June 2025 Nutrients

Monacolins – upcoming ban on use in food?

In February 2025, the European Food Safety Authority (EFSA) published its safety assessment of monacolins from red yeast rice, including monacolin K, as part of the Article 8 procedure of the Regulation (EC) No 1925/2006. Monacolins are currently listed in the list of substances whose use is restricted in accordance with Annex III, Part B of Regulation (EC) No 1925/2006. Following the withdrawal of the health claim for monacolin K by the EU Commission in mid-2024, a complete ban on the use of monacolins from red yeast rice in food is now expected based on EFSA's current safety assessment.

09. May 2025 Additives

EFSA completes re-evaluation of saccharins (E 954)

In November 2024, the European Food Safety Authority (EFSA) published its opinion on the re-evaluation of the food additive saccharin and its sodium, potassium, and calcium salts (E 954). EFSA concludes that saccharins are safe for human consumption, but that the specifications regarding the manufacturing process and purity criteria need to be adjusted.

07. March 2025 Additives

EFSA completes re-evaluation of silicon dioxide (E 551)

In October 2024, the European Food Safety Authority (EFSA) completed its follow-up on the re-evaluation of silicon dioxide (E 551) as a food additive for use in foods for all population groups, including infants below 16 weeks of age. EFSA classifies the use of E 551 as safe. Only amendments of the specifications in Regulation (EU) No. 231/2012 is expected around the end of 2025.

10. December 2024 Allergens

ALTS/ALS updates threshold levels for soy, celery, lupin and mustard

At its 93rd workshop, the ALTS ("Arbeitskreis der auf dem Gebiet der Lebensmittelhygiene und der Lebensmittel tierischer Herkunft tätigen Sachverständigen”) and the ALS ("Arbeitskreis Lebensmittelchemischer Sachverständiger der Länder und des Bundesamtes für Verbraucherschutz und Lebensmittelsicherheit”) jointly decided to publish updated threshold levels for the allergens soy, celery, lupin and mustard and to adapt to the recent recommendations of the Joint FAO/WHO expert consultation on risk assessment of food allergens.
